Crushed concrete is a fantastic option when it comes to filling in potholes and cracks on roads. Not only is it environmentally friendly, but it can also be a cost-effective solution for repairing damaged surfaces. When we use crushed concrete for road repairs, we are essentially recycling old concrete that would otherwise end up in a landfill. By choosing to repurpose this material, we are reducing the amount of waste that goes into our environment and helping to conserve natural resources. This makes crushed concrete a sustainable choice for road maintenance projects. In addition to its environmental benefits, using crushed concrete can also save money. Because recycled concrete is readily available and often less expensive than traditional materials, such as gravel or asphalt, it can help lower the overall costs of repairing potholes and cracks. This makes it an attractive option for municipalities looking to stretch their budgets without compromising on quality. Overall, crushed concrete offers a win-win solution for filling in potholes and cracks on roads. By choosing this eco-friendly and cost-effective material, we can not only improve the safety and appearance of our roadways but also contribute to a more sustainable future for generations to come.
Filling in potholes and cracks on your driveway or road can be a tedious task, but with the right materials and technique, it can be done effectively. One method that is commonly used is filling them in with crushed concrete. This material is durable and can provide a long-lasting solution to repair damaged areas. To start the process, you will need to gather the necessary tools and materials, including crushed concrete, a shovel, a tamper, and safety gear such as gloves and goggles. Once you have everything ready, you can begin by cleaning out the pothole or crack to remove any debris or loose material. Next, fill the hole with crushed concrete until it is slightly above ground level. Use the shovel to spread the material evenly and compact it as much as possible using a tamper. Make sure to tamp down each layer of crushed concrete to ensure that it is tightly packed and stable. After filling in the pothole or crack with crushed concrete, allow it to dry completely before driving over it. This will ensure that the material sets properly and provides a solid surface for vehicles to drive on. In conclusion, filling in potholes and cracks using crushed concrete requires patience and attention to detail. By following these step-by-step instructions, you can successfully repair damaged areas on your driveway or road with this durable material.

In today's construction and landscaping projects, sustainability is more important than ever. A key material that is gaining attention for its eco-friendly and economic benefits is recycled concrete. As interest for eco-friendly building materials increases, recycled concrete is becoming a preferred choice for base applications in various construction and landscaping projects. Here’s why choosing recycled concrete is a smart decision.
Perhaps the most notable advantages of using recycled concrete is its environmental impact. By repurposing old concrete that would otherwise end up in landfills, we reduce the need for new raw materials, such as gravel and crushed stone. This process helps to conserve natural resources and reduces the environmental footprint of construction projects.
Additionally, the recycling process reduces greenhouse gas emissions associated with the production and transportation of new materials. The process of breaking down and reusing existing concrete consumes less energy compared to quarrying, processing, and transporting virgin materials. This energy efficiency leads to lower carbon emissions, aligning with global efforts to fight climate change.
Recycled concrete is often more affordable than new, virgin materials. Because it is sourced from demolished structures and reprocessed for new construction, the cost of extraction, processing, and transportation is reduced. For contractors and homeowners looking to save on project budgets, recycled concrete offers a cost-effective alternative without compromising quality.
Moreover, utilizing recycled concrete can lower overall project expenses by lowering disposal costs. Instead of spending money to haul and dispose of old concrete, contractors can break it down and repurpose it on-site, saving both time and money.
Despite some common myths, recycled concrete can be as effective as new materials in many applications. When appropriately processed and graded, recycled concrete can offer superior durability and stability as a base material for various construction applications. Its ability to compact well ensures a solid foundation that can withstand heavy loads and prevent settling over time.
Recycled concrete also offers good drainage properties, which is crucial for outdoor surfaces like driveways and walkways. Proper drainage helps avoid water accumulation, lowering the risk of deterioration from freeze-thaw cycles in colder climates.
Recycled concrete is incredibly versatile and can be used in various applications outside of driveways and walkways. It serves as an excellent base material for patios, retaining walls, and roadways, providing a strong foundation that can support a range of structures. Its flexibility makes it an ideal choice for a variety of landscaping and construction projects.

When filling in potholes and cracks on your driveway, it's important to properly compact the crushed concrete to ensure a durable surface that will last for years to come. Compacting the material effectively will help prevent future damage and keep your driveway looking smooth and even. To start, make sure the pothole or crack is clean and free of any debris. Use a shovel or rake to remove any loose gravel or dirt from the area. Once the hole is cleared out, fill it with crushed concrete until it is slightly overflowing. This extra material will help ensure a solid base once it is compacted. Next, use a tamper or compactor to firmly pack down the crushed concrete. Start at the edges of the hole and work your way towards the center, applying firm pressure as you go. Make sure to compact the material evenly across the entire surface to avoid any weak spots that could lead to future cracking or sinking. After compacting, check the level of the filled area with a straight edge or level tool. Add more crushed concrete if needed to create a smooth, even surface. Once you are satisfied with the levelness, give the repaired area time to settle and cure before driving on it. By following these tips on properly compacting crushed concrete, you can ensure a durable driveway surface that will stand up to daily wear and tear. Taking the time to do this job right will save you time and money in the long run by preventing future damage and prolonging the life of your driveway.
When it comes to filling in potholes and cracks on your driveway, it is important to not only repair the damaged areas but also seal them properly. Sealing the repaired areas helps prevent future damage and can greatly extend the lifespan of your driveway. Potholes and cracks are not just unsightly, they can also pose a safety hazard for vehicles and pedestrians. By filling them in with the appropriate materials, you can smooth out the surface of your driveway and create a safer environment for everyone. However, simply filling in the potholes and cracks is not enough. It is crucial to seal these repaired areas to protect them from further wear and tear. Sealing helps to prevent water from seeping into the cracks, which can cause them to expand during freezing temperatures. This expansion can lead to even larger cracks forming, resulting in more extensive damage to your driveway. In addition to preventing future damage, sealing the repaired areas also helps to prolong the lifespan of your driveway. By creating a protective barrier over the filled-in potholes and cracks, you can help maintain the structural integrity of your driveway for years to come. In conclusion, sealing the repaired areas on your driveway is essential for preventing future damage and extending its lifespan. So next time you fill in those pesky potholes and cracks, make sure to seal them properly for long-lasting results.
